🫘 Kidneys

Verdict: Generally allowed on the Tayibat reference list (as shown on this site).

Category: Meat & protein

Is Kidneys allowed on the Tayibat diet? Yes — reference photo on Mytayibat
Is Kidneys allowed on the Tayibat diet? Yes — reference photo on Mytayibat

Short answer

Generally allowed ✅ — Listed on Tayibat: Kidneys — Long-cooked, moderate amounts.

How to use "Kidneys" on Tayibat

Prefer boiling, grilling, or slow cooking without heavy sauces. Eat at true hunger, stop before uncomfortable fullness, and pair with allowed staples from the allowed & forbidden hub.

Selection & storage

Choose fresh, simple ingredients without ultra-processed add-ons. Store per food safety basics; reheat thoroughly. If tolerance is low, introduce small portions over a week.
